Is fiber the fastest internet I can get in State Road?
The fastest internet for you may vary based on where in State Road you live. In general, cable competes most often with fiber in the city.
- Fiber is the fastest internet type for 88.91% of State Road homes.
- Cable is fastest for 9.43% of the city.
- DSL is fastest for less than 1%.
- Fixed wireless is fastest for less than 1%.
- Satellite internet may be the only option for 1.04% of State Road homes.
